Also I was having quite a few problems recently with PS3MS taking forever to find directories whilst in the PS3 interface and I decided to look into the problem.

Identify

If you go to the traces tab and you have errors about the database being read / locked, then you have a problem.

Solution

Close PS3MS

Navigate to C:\Program Files (x86)\PS3 Media Server\

Delete the folder Database

Run PS3MS

Go to traces tab and note down the line [main] TRACE <TIME> A tiny media library admin interface is available at : http://192.168.0.5:5001/console/home (<- IP address will be different as this is obviously mine)

Enter the IP Address, port number and directory that you got in the last step

On the web page choose Scan Folders (this can take some time)

It will now create a new database in the AppData\Roaming folder which it can access, read and modify, which should greatly improve PS3 media browsing.

New update, quite a few changes

Latest builds [2010-01-29] / Current revision: 381

Windows: http://ps3mediaserve...g/files/pms-set ... 11.381.exe

Linux: http://ps3mediaserve...ux-1.11.381.tgz

changelog between r381 and r369:

- Mplayer builds from 2010-01-19 (Regular and MT): http://oss.netfarm.i...layer-win32.php

- DVD ISO muxing enabled by default + DTS support (need some tests :p). It's an option in the transcode settings panel

- New Mplayer build font cache should build if needed at start

- Definitive removal of the tsmuxer mpeg parser (slow and now unnecessary with recent ffmpeg builds)

- New option to avoid music files resampling

- Better support for simultaneous usage with several ps3s/renderers (need tests as well)

- Better support for Sony Bravia TVs for all regions (no need to tweak that conf file by hand)

- 5.0 Audio channel support

- Small fixes

DVD ISO muxing is quite a big addition.

    • Microsoft releases Visual Studio Code 1.124 with smarter autonomous AI agents by Paul Hill Microsoft has just released Visual Studio Code 1.124 with a focus on faster agent workflows and improved agent autonomy. Microsoft outlined the following features as the key items in this update: Autopilot: Autopilot, enabled by default, is now smarter to determine when a task is truly done. Background sessions: Quickly send a request in the background and keep composing the next session. Session navigation: Search, jump, and step through agent sessions with the keyboard. Browser history: Revisit and search pages you've already opened in the integrated browser. With VS Code 1.124, Microsoft has enabled Autopilot by default. For those that don’t know, Autopilot is a chat permission level that you can pick to give agents permission to take initiative and act autonomously, without needing explicit user approval for each action. Also related to Autopilot, Microsoft introduced Advanced Autopilot, which changes how Autopilot decides when to keep iterating and when to finish. This helps you get more complete results without manually monitoring loops. This feature works using a small utility model that reads a transcript of the chat and decides when the task is done. Another new feature in 1.124 is the Agents window, which lets you easily explore, iterate on, and review agent sessions across projects and machines. Previously, starting a new agent session meant waiting for it to load before you could compose the next one. With this update, sessions can be requested in the background. This VS Code update also brings session navigation updates to switch between them more quickly. The update also lets you reload or reopen the Agents window so that it no longer loses your layout, so you will land back where you left off. If you use the integrated browser in VS Code, you will notice that it now retains the history of visited pages. Suggestions will now show when typing in the URL bar and can be managed by using Ctrl+H within a browser tab. The browser now also lets you customize the toolbar more; just right-click on the toolbar area to the right of the URL input. Finally, the browser has faster agentic text entry. Another improvement is experimental enterprise-managed Copilot plugin policies that allow admins to centrally control which chat plugins and plugin marketplaces are available to developers.
